Sophisticated Techniques for Proper Brushing
To genuinely elevate your tooth care routine, consider varying your brushing methods. One proven approach is the Bass method, where you position your toothbrush at 45 degrees toward the gum line. This approach helps to eliminate plaque from below the gum margin, ensuring a thorough clean. Remember to make gentle circular motions rather than forceful scrubbing, as this can harm both your gums and enamel.
Additionally, technique to incorporate is the modified Stillman technique, which is particularly advantageous for those with sensitive gums. In this method, you hold the brush against the gums and make small circular strokes while shifting the brush along the teeth. This approach not only removes debris from the teeth but softly stimulates the gums, promoting enhanced blood flow and overall gum health.
Finally, think about the walker technique for cleaning the inner surfaces of your teeth. Here, you grip the brush vertically and use swift up-and-down strokes. This method can be especially useful for the back teeth, where plaque tends to build up more easily. By adding these advanced techniques into your brushing routine, you can enhance your tooth care and maintain a healthier smile.
The Significance of Routine Check-Ups
Frequent visits to a dental clinic are crucial for maintaining optimal oral health. These check-ups allow dentists to spot issues that may not be evident to the naked eye, such as tooth decay or periodontal disease. By detecting these problems in their early stages, you can steer clear of more extensive treatments in the future, reducing you both time and money.
Moreover, a dentist can furnish tailored advice based on your individual oral hygiene routine. They can suggest specific products or techniques that align with your individual needs, helping you boost your daily care. This tailored guidance secures that you are making the most effective steps to keep a beautiful smile.
Lastly, frequent check-ups encourage preventive care, which is crucial to a sustained vibrant mouth. Teeth cleanings at the dentist clinic not only clear away plaque and tartar but also contribute to fresh breath and a more attractive smile. By investing in routine visits, you are committing in your overall health and can reap the benefits of a confident and healthy grin.
Selecting the Right Dental Items
Choosing the right oral items is crucial for preserving optimal dental hygiene. Begin with your brush; seek out one with feather-like bristles to reduce harm to the gums while efficiently removing plaque. An automated toothbrush can be a fantastic choice for those who want to ensure they are cleaning completely and efficiently. Think about getting a toothbrush with a timing function to assist you stick to the suggested two minute duration of cleaning.
